squiggle
squiggle is defined in Webster's Unabridged Dictionary (1913) with 2 senses. The full text of each entry is reproduced verbatim below.
Definitions
- 1.To shake and wash a fluid about in the mouth with the lips closed. [Prov. Eng.] Forby.
- 2.To move about like an eel; to squirm. [Low, U.S.] Bartlett.
